Andrew Walker}, title = {Scientific Opinion: Improving the Definition of Grape Phylloxera Biotypes and Standardizing Biotype Screening Protocols}, volume = {67}, number = {4}, pages = {371--376}, year = {2016}, doi = {10.5344/ajev.2016.15106}, publisher = {American Journal of Enology and Viticulture}, abstract = {Grape phylloxera biotypes are defined by their specific performance on, or preference for, a particular host (e.g., feeding on a particular rootstock). Numerous studies have phenotyped phylloxera biotypes, particularly with regard to their performance on various hosts, but the results are difficult to compare because there is neither a homogenous nomenclature nor a standardized protocol for phenotyping. To improve communication within the scientific community, we offer a simplified phylloxera biotype classification to allow clear data interpretation and effective communication. We also introduce the standard techniques employed for phylloxera phenotyping and discuss their advantages and disadvantages.}, issn = {0002-9254}, URL = {https://www.ajevonline.org/content/67/4/371}, eprint = {https://www.ajevonline.org/content/67/4/371.full.pdf}, journal = {American Journal of Enology and Viticulture} }
